Real estate inKearney, Missouri

Kearney, MO has about 4,253 households and a median household income of $102,523. Roughly 76% of homes are owner-occupied, the median owner's home value is $275,200, 34%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ute runs 26.2 minutes. The Census counts 10,696 residents. New construction is still adding supply: 2 building permits were issued in 2026-07.

Kearney, MO has 94 homes for sale right now, with a median list price of $530,000 as of Sep 11 These homes were built between 1940 and 2026, ranging from 1,064 to 6,508 square feet.

How we compute these
Under contract.
Homes with an accepted contract that have not closed yet. A live count.
Days to contract.
The middle number of days between a home being listed and going under contract, over the last 90 days of closings. It is not days-to-close, and it is not how long today's listings have been sitting. Newly built homes are excluded, because a build finishing is not a market moving.

How we compute these
Market.
Market type is set by months of supply — how long it would take to sell every home for sale at the current pace. Under ~4 months favors sellers (low inventory, faster sales, homes near or above asking); over ~6 favors buyers (more choice, more negotiating room). 4–6 is balanced.
Months supply.
How many months it would take to sell every home now for sale at the pace of the last 90 days: homes for sale ÷ (closings in the last 90 days ÷ 3).
